Abstract: We consider the initial-value problem for the equivariant Schr"odinger maps near a family of harmonic maps. We provide some supplemental arguments for the proof of local well-posedness result by Gustafson, Kang and Tsai in [Duke Math. J. 145(3) 537--583, 2008]. We also prove that the solution near harmonic maps is unique in C(I;dotH1(mathbbR2)capdotH2(mathbbR2)) for time interval I. In the proof, we give a justification of the derivation of the modified Schr"odinger map equation in low regularity settings without smallness of energy.
